Why do all these frickin' websites assume we all want to connect every bit of our lives online to our various profiles and personalities? I like to keep them separate, thank you very much, for various reasons.

And yes, I know, you can choose not to share, but it's the rising number of requests to connect this social service with that one and so on and so forth that sets my teeth on edge. </end rant>
